Can I receive a refund on my tuition fees at Canadian College in Vancouver?

2 Views|Posted 3 days ago
Asked by Shiksha User
1 Answer
A
3 days ago

Yes, students can receive a refund on their tuition fee at the Canadian College, Vancouver. Students will need to send their visa refusal letter and a refund request form to the college.

No, Canadian College Vancouver does not offer PGWP-eligible programs. Despite its status as a Designated Learning Institute, its programs are not eligible for a PGWP, as it is a private institution.
